About the Position

This permanent full-time position, in Medicine Hat, AB, works with a team of professionals to support children and youth in a community group home. Utilizing the Teaching Family Model as a holistic approach, you will facilitate success for children and youth by assisting with day to day activities and routines, maintaining a structured setting, fostering skill development, managing crises, ensuring high levels of supervision to promote safety, and assisting with schoolwork and household duties.

Responsibilities


  • Implementing and documenting hourly room checks

  • Investigating any unusual night time activity in the house and contacting on-call or supervisory staff as needed to assist with any emergencies

  • Managing crises in a therapeutic manner

  • Supporting children and youth with strategies to enhance their mental, physical, emotional and spiritual well-being, and to increase their sense of belonging

  • Completing day to day household tasks such as cooking, cleaning and other duties as required

  • Transporting youth to and from school, appointments or visits


Qualifications


  • A diploma or degree in a related field is preferred and a minimum of 6 months of previous experience working with vulnerable children and/or families; a combination of education and experience will be considered

  • Experience working in Community Group Care or other \"in-care\" programs (preferred)

  • Experience providing trauma-informed, family-sensitive and culturally responsive care

  • Willing to work an unstructured work week, consisting of 12-hour shifts, including evenings, weekends, and holidays.

  • Ability to manage a crisis situation in a therapeutic manner, and, if necessary, intervene physically in a manner that reduces the risk of harm.

  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ills and ability to effectively communicate with and relate to people of all ages

  • Detail oriented and organized, able to manage multiple priorities at the same time

  • Eager to learn and carry out the principles and philosophy of Closer to Home and the Teaching Family Model

  • Compassionate individual with a positive, empathetic and relational approach

  • A reliable vehicle for work purposes

  • Can work full-time in Canada without sponsorship
